19 namespace llvm {
20 
21 class raw_ostream;
22 
23 /// Simple wrapper around std::function<void(raw_ostream&)>.
24 /// This class is useful to construct print helpers for raw_ostream.
25 ///
26 /// Example:
27 ///     Printable printRegister(unsigned Register) {
28 ///       return Printable([Register](raw_ostream &OS) {
29 ///         OS << getRegisterName(Register);
30 ///       });
31 ///     }
32 ///     ... OS << printRegister(Register); ...
33 ///
34 /// Implementation note: Ideally this would just be a typedef, but doing so
35 /// leads to operator << being ambiguous as function has matching constructors
36 /// in some STL versions. I have seen the problem on gcc 4.6 libstdc++ and
37 /// microsoft STL.
38 class Printable {
39 public:
40   std::function<void(raw_ostream &OS)> Print;
41   Printable(std::function<void(raw_ostream &OS)> Print)
42       : Print(std::move(Print)) {}
43 };
44 
45 inline raw_ostream &operator<<(raw_ostream &OS, const Printable &P) {
46   P.Print(OS);
47   return OS;
48 }
49 
50 } // namespace llvm
